Duke Primary Care, part of Duke University Health System, is hiring a Radiologic Technologist at the Blue Ridge location. This full-time position involves operating x-ray equipment, ensuring radiographic safety, and supporting physicians with fluoroscopic procedures and image processing. Eligible for a $15,000 commitment bonus and $3,000 relocation assistance.
New graduates and experienced technologists are welcome. ARRT certification and BLS are required to apply.
